Our guest this week is Gatete Nyiringabo. A lawyer by profession, he is a writer, activist, and civil society voice. We discuss the state of civil society in Rwanda, exploring its self-imposed weaknesses and how it can overcome them. Gatete also shares insights on recent developments, including the implications of surrogacy laws and the concerning invitation of notorious genocidaires to the DRC.
